bembaman Posted December 24, 2006 Report Share Posted December 24, 2006 I had the 'blue screen of death' occur recently on several occasions, different messages.I backed everything up and got a new hard drive. However, I am trying to install XP SP2 and have encountered a problem. The set up goes fine and I get as far as installng the installation files to the installation folders (ie the bit where the yellow installation bar reaches 100%) The computer then restarts, which I think is normal, but then when it re-starts it just goes back to booting off the CD as a completely fresh installation and reaches the same point again and restarts etc. I am going round in circles.Anyone got the answer for this, and is my initial assumption that it is hardware related wrong? cozofdeath Posted December 24, 2006 Report Share Posted December 24, 2006 The problem of it restarting like that doesn't seem like a hardware problem to me. If you were getting blue screens when you were installing then maybe. Have you tried, when it restarts, to take out the cd and see if it reads off the hard drive?
